Winnipeg, Ward—Quartier No. 3, Manitoba (1901 census)
Winnipeg, Ward—Quartier No. 3 was a census subdivision in Manitoba, recorded in the 1901 Census of Canada with a population of 5,621. The administrative centroid was at approximately 49.893°N, 97.178°W.
Population
In 1901, Winnipeg, Ward—Quartier No. 3 had a population of 5,621: 2,734 male and 2,887 female residents. Population density was 1264.0 people per square mile.
Population trajectory across census years
| Year | Population |
|---|---|
| 1891 | 1,976 |
| 1901 | 5,621 |
